FWIW, I leave the coil open so that it stays clear of ice in the winter. I prefer an open coil over a closed one for a couple of reasons. One it's more robust, wound coils are usually delicate and the magnet wire thin. Second, being closed they usually end up leaking and that causes corrosion and sometimes a freeze/thaw cycle ruins them.
